ERP Systems for End-to-End Customer Journey Management

Modern businesses are no longer focused solely on internal operations. Customer expectations now demand seamless experiences across every interaction, from initial engagement to post-sale support. ERP systems play a critical role in managing the entire customer journey by connecting sales, operations, service, finance, and supply chain data into a unified platform. An integrated ERP environment helps organizations improve responsiveness, personalization, and long-term customer satisfaction.
